Post#13 by Ahau » 07 Nov 2012, 18:52

I don't use conky so I'm not familiar with the configuration, but I've been compiling some stuff for Xfce and added the 'cpu-graph-plugin', which displays cpu usage for each processor in the panel (Xfce only, I'd imagine). I have an intel i5 quad-core as well, and all four processors were shown in the cpu graph, they all showed independent reads as I ran different processes, and when I was compiling some programs with 'make -j8', all four processers were maxed out. Add to this the fact that the new machine compiles WAY faster than my old dual core machine, and I'm positive all 4 cores are being recognized and utilized.
